ON WITH LIFE INC, founded in 1987, is a mid-sized nonprofit that reported $24.4M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 27%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$20.9M left a modest 15% surplus.

Mission

JOINING HANDS, HEARTS, AND MINDS TO HELP PERSONS LIVING WITH BRAIN INJURY GET ON WITH LIFE. TO BE THE PROVIDER OF CHOICE IN BRAIN INJURY REHABILITATION.

ANKENY INPATIENT: ON WITH LIFE'S POST-ACUTE INPATIENT REHABILITATION PROGRAM IS A 28-BED, CARF ACCREDITED PROGRAM THAT PROVIDES INTENSE THERAPY TO THOSE THAT HAVE SUSTAINED A TRAUMATIC BRAIN INJURY, STROKE, TUMOR, LOSS OF OXYGEN OR OTHER NEUROLOGICAL CONDITION. ON WITH LIFE IS A UNIQUE ONE- OF-A-KIND FACILITY. OUR EXTENSIVE REHABILITATION EXPERIENCE AND OUR EXPERTISE IN THE TREATMENT OF INDIVIDUALS WITH BRAIN INJURY OFFER INDIVIDUALS THE OPTIMAL OPPORTUNITY TO ACHIEVE THEIR GOALS.

COMBINED OUTPATIENT THERAPY: ON WITH LIFE'S OUTPATIENT NEURO REHABILITATION PROGRAM CONSISTS OF TWO CLINICS (ANKENY AND CORALVILLE) AND A COMPREHENSIVE TEAM OF SPECIALISTS WHO ARE DEDICATED TO PROVIDING THE HIGHEST LEVEL OF CARE AND SERVICE THROUGH A TRANSDISCIPLINARY, COLLABORATIVE TEAM APPROACH. OUR AREAS OF EXPERTISE INCLUDE BRAIN INJURY, STROKE, CONCUSSION, PARKINSON'S DISEASE AND COMPLEX NEUROLOGICAL CONDITIONS. OUR PROGRAM IS STAFFED WITH A TEAM OF THERAPISTS TRAINED IN NEURO-BASED PHYSICAL THERAPY, OCCUPATIONAL THERAPY, SPEECH THERAPY, NEUROPSYCHOLOGY AND CLINICAL COUNSELING.

RNR HOUSE: ON WITH LIFE'S RESIDENTIAL NEURO REHABILITATION PROGRAM IS A FIVE-BEDROOM RESIDENTIAL HOME FOCUSED ON WORKING WITH INDIVIDUALS WHO HAVE SUSTAINED A BRAIN INJURY AS THEY LEARN STRATEGIES TO SUPPORT THEIR RETURN HOME AND TO THEIR COMMUNITIES. THE REHABILITATION TEAM FOCUSES ON PROMOTING THE OVERALL HEALTH OF THE PERSON SERVED, COMMUNITY INTEGRATION, INDEPENDENT LIVING SKILL-BUILDING AND MANAGING NEUROBEHAVIORAL CHALLENGES.
